Operating Modes
Terminals
Earth
Connects to the Earth (green lead).
Output
Connects to the Fence (red lead)
Off
The Energizer is off.
If you are not using the Energizer for extended periods,
disconnect battery from the Energizer.
Full Power
The Energizer operates at maximum energy and normal
pulse interval.
Night Save
The Energizer slows the pulse interval during low light
conditions to extend battery life. This operating mode
extends the battery life by approximately one and a half
times and is useful for controlling animals that are less
active at night.
Random (B50, BX50 only)
The Energizer pulse interval varies in a random fashion
up to a maximum of 5 seconds to extend battery life. This
operating mode extends the battery life by approximately
two times, and provides effective animal control for
domestic animals that are familiar with electric fences.
SensePulse (BX50 only)
Energizer monitors the fence voltage and fence load with
each pulse and automatically increases its output when an
animal (or other load) is in contact with the fence. This
operating mode extends the battery life by approximately
three times, and provides effective animal control for
domestic animals that are familiar with electric fences.
